Also, Alexi recently was awarded her own TV series on HGTV! Home improvement and design come naturally to Alexi Panos, Host of HGTV’s Run My Makeover. Her desire to pursue carpentry and design began when she was a young girl, as she watched her father build her childhood home. Fascinated by the construction process, Alexi was on-site every day after school, helping her father select everything from cabinets to carpets. Alexi’s mother, who bought homes to refurbish and sell, instilled a love of interior design in Alexi by showing her how small changes can give new life to an old space. Alexi, who became known as a "design guru" to her friends, says she is ready to tackle any design dilemma in her new TV series. (Show airs starting July 2011).

In 2008 EPIC teamed up with the new Quiksilver Women's line, who donated 3% of all of their eco-friendly clothing sales in 2009 to the drilling of EPIC's clean water wells.

With the extraordinary help of Quiksilver, along with many of your generous donations, EPIC was able to drill their 2nd and 3rd wells in the villages of Mangalali and Kibebe.

In 2010, the 3% royalty rate will come from all of the QSW stylish Eco-Friendly Tees and with their continuous support, along with all of your kind donations, EPIC will be drilling 3 more clean water wells in 2010. Please visit our Projects section to learn more!

Alexi Tenille at wellThe first of 4 successful wells! The first one was at Kawe Primary School, Tanzania, Africa - bringing fresh water to a village of over 5,000 people! (Aug, 2007)

(Everyday People Initiating Change) began as a non-profit organization, but has now become what we believe to be one of the most important movements of our time.The purpose of E.P.I.C. is to make people aware of how easy it is to contribute positively to our world.Our presentation within your school meets various NJ and NY State Core-Curriculum requirements under: Character Education, Geography, and Anti-bullying/Anti-Violence education. Your students will relate to the fact that Alexi and Tennille are young people themselves, currently making world-changes; and will view moving films of the girls working with students in Tanzania, Africa. The School administration will delight in the fact that Alexi was a 4.0 Talented & Gifted Student, who exempted 11th grade, and who speaks about the importance of being successful in education and how it opens the world of opportunity for all young people.

The birth of E.P.I.C. was a result of two individuals, Alexi Panos & Tennille Amor, Co-Founders of E.P.I.C, who shared the same vision; feeling a strong calling to initiate change in the way that people live their lives today.It all begins with the commitment to living a conscious life, and the acceptance of the responsibility to spread this state of consciousness to everyone we possibly can.
